I was a bit disappointed. The guy at the front desk was very pleasant but a bit robotic in his answers and information. I had to ask for hangers and there was no hair dryer. The shower curtian was so thin and too long that it created a flood in the bathroom. Then when we asked for more towels to clean it up they asked me to return any unused towels! The grab n go breakfast is a nice thought but my apple was rotten. The room had a bad smell too.

Don't waste your time or money. We paid for a King with our reservation, but got a Full Size bed. Pillows were flat & not comfortable. Good luck watching TV at night because it sits below the bed at a weird angle. Housekeeping only comes every 2 days (what hotel does this)!? Plus they charge $10 if you request housekeeping. Only 1 trash can in the room and that's in the bathroom- even though they have a kitchen (oh, without dishes, you can pay extra for those too).

Good if you need an apartment style The hotel is a long stay style with kitchenettes. The walls and ceilings are thin, so get on the top floor. You have to bring your own soap and shampoo. The morning coffee is good, but only junk type food to grab and go. Probably decent for the price in San Diego. The rooms are nicer than Motel 6.
